Job Summary:

We are seeking a highly skilled Residential Drain Technician to join our team in Conroe, TX. As a key member of our team, you will be responsible for providing top-notch drainage services to our customers, ensuring their satisfaction and loyalty.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Diagnose and resolve drainage issues in residential properties, providing clear explanations and options to customers.
  • Clean drains in homes and commercial buildings using cable or high-pressure water jetting.
  • Perform pipe inspections using cameras and unclog sewers, sinks, toilets, and other plumbing fixtures.
  • Maintain and fuel company vehicles, stock service trucks with necessary parts, and ensure machinery is in good working condition.
  • Transport materials and tools to job sites and maintain accurate records of services performed.
  • Collect and record fees, and deliver them to the office as required.

Requirements:

  • A valid Texas Plumbing License.
  • 2 years' experience in drains, preferably.
  • A valid driver's license with a good driving record.
  • Ability to work evenings and weekends as required.
